Distinguish between a proactive and reactive police agency. What major characteristics identify the proactive police agency?
What will be an ideal response?
The major approach of a proactive police agency is to plan ahead to prevent crime. A reactive department wastes time and resources on random patrol while often ignoring crime trends and activities, and the need for future planning. The proactive department plans ahead to help citizens prevent violence and crime through proactive community policing.
